The surname Chomski has a rich history and widespread distribution across various countries. In this article, we will delve into the origins of the surname, its meaning, and the incidence of its usage in different regions around the world.
The surname Chomski is of Polish origin, where it likely originated as a patronymic surname derived from the given name Chomek. In Polish naming tradition, the suffix "-ski" or "-ska" is added to the root of the father's name to create a surname for the son. Therefore, Chomski is believed to mean "son of Chomek."
Chomek itself is a diminutive form of the common Polish given name Tomasz, which is equivalent to Thomas in English. This suggests that individuals with the surname Chomski may have descended from ancestors named Chomek, who was likely named after an ancestor named Tomasz.
The surname Chomski is most prevalent in Poland, where it has a high incidence of 291 individuals bearing the name. This indicates that the surname has a strong presence in its country of origin and is likely to be found in various regions across Poland.
Outside of Poland, the surname Chomski has a significant presence in Catalonia, Spain, with 35 individuals bearing the name. This suggests that the surname may have migrated to Spain at some point in history, possibly through emigration or other means.
In Argentina, the surname Chomski is less common but still present, with an incidence of 18 individuals. This indicates that the surname has made its way to South America, possibly through immigration or other forms of population movement.
In the United States, the surname Chomski has a moderate incidence of 13 individuals. This suggests that individuals with the surname may have migrated to the US from Poland or other countries where the surname is prevalent.
In Moldova and Israel, the surname Chomski has a similar incidence of 12 and 10 individuals, respectively. This indicates that the surname has a presence in these countries as well, although to a slightly lesser extent compared to Poland and Spain.
In Russia, Brazil, Sweden, Germany, and England, the surname Chomski has a more limited presence, with incidence ranging from 1 to 5 individuals. This suggests that the surname may be less common or less widely distributed in these countries compared to others.
